Patents Assigned to Digital Recording Research Limited Partnership
  • Patent number: 4882754
    Abstract: In a digital encoder, truncation is controlled by the fullness of the output rate-smoothing buffer. A signal compression system is shown for processing a stream of fixed length digital sample signals, such as audio signals, which system includes a linear digital compression filter for compression filtering the sample signal stream and generating a stream of compression-filtered signals. The compression-filtered stream is encoded by an encoder which implements a variable word length truncated code. The encoder output is supplied to a buffer for transmission to a communication channel. The encoder is controllably operable in a normal mode and in an out of range (OOR) mode. In the OOR operating mode an OOR code word together with the compression filtered signal is sent to the buffer. Buffer underflow is controlled by operation in the OOR mode when the buffer is empty or near empty.
    Type: Grant
    Filed: June 9, 1988
    Date of Patent: November 21, 1989
    Assignees: Digideck, Inc., Digital Recording Research Limited Partnership
    Inventors: Charles S. Weaver, Constance T. Chittenden, Allen B. Conner, Jr.
  • Patent number: 4841299
    Abstract: Encoding and decoding method and apparatus are disclosed including a decoder for decoding a stream of encoded digital data words which have been encoded by an encoder using variable length code words in which the code words comprise a single group of 0 bits followed by a single group of 1 bits. The 0 bits and 1 bits are separately counted (46), and the combined counts are used to address a read only memory (54) containing the decoded digital data words. The decoded digital data word is read out from the addressed memory location. Also disclosed is an AND gate array 70 of rows and columns of AND gates (90-1 etc.), in which the number of 0s in the code word determines which row is energized, and the number of 1s in the code word determines which column is energized. The energized AND gate is indicative of the decoded digital data word.
    Type: Grant
    Filed: August 31, 1987
    Date of Patent: June 20, 1989
    Assignee: Digital Recording Research Limited Partnership
    Inventor: Charles S. Weaver
  • Patent number: 4546342
    Abstract: A music data compression system is disclosed which includes an analog to digital converter for converting the analog music signal to digital sample signal form, a digital compression filter for compression filtering the digital sample signals, and an encoder for truncated Huffman encoding the compression filter output. An entropy setting unit is included in the system for step control of the signal supplied to the digital compression filter in accordance with one or more threshold levels of the envelope of the music signal, and for reducing the entropy of the signal with increases in the energy level of the music signal. Different codes may be implemented in accordance with the threshold(s), and an identifying code word is inserted in the Huffman encoded stream. A decoder, digital reconstruction filter, and digital to analog converter are used to reconstruct the analog music signal.
    Type: Grant
    Filed: December 14, 1983
    Date of Patent: October 8, 1985
    Assignee: Digital Recording Research Limited Partnership
    Inventors: Charles S. Weaver, Robert A. LeBlanc, Lawrence E. Sweeney, Jr.
  • Patent number: 4535320
    Abstract: Method and apparatus for decoding Huffman encoded words are disclosed which include the use of logic gates connected in the form of a binary decoding tree which includes branches, interior and leaf nodes. Bits of the encoded word are sequentially supplied to gates of the binary tree. Simultaneously, gate enable signals are supplied to gates of the binary tree. Both the data bits and enable signals are supplied to gates at increasingly higher levels of the binary tree. When an output is obtained from a gate associated with one of the leaf nodes of the tree, the process of sequentially supplying data bits and enable signals to gates of the binary tree is repeated for the next encoded word. The original data words are regenerated by use of outputs from said gates associated with leaf nodes of the binary tree.
    Type: Grant
    Filed: June 22, 1984
    Date of Patent: August 13, 1985
    Assignee: Digital Recording Research Limited Partnership
    Inventor: Charles S. Weaver